Something that occurred to me after
reading the writeup - there is a kind of "middle case" that is
perhaps worthy of consideration. This
is to deal with the problem of forcing a "heavyweight
mechanism" onto the developer during
the development and test phase of some SCA application,
in the form of the External Attachment
mechanism.
So, a possible halfway house:
- allow attachment of PolicySets directly
to specific elements in the SCDL, but have a rule that
the external attachment mechanism overrides
any such attachment.
- so during development and test, the
developer can attach whatever PolicySets to elements of
concern.
- at deployment, the deployer can use
the External Attach mechanism to apply PolicySets to any
places - in the full and certain knowledge
that any developer-attached PolicySets will be overridden
and will not apply.
- this does allow for some cases where
the EA mechanism does not place any PolicySets on a given
element, where the developer did apply
some - in which the developer's PolicySets will still apply.
Of course, you can argue that this is
a hole in the EA plan - ie some places which could have a policies
applied don't have them applied via
EA. An alternative is to call this an error case...
